Africa-Press – Angola. The MPLA’s first secretary in Cuanza-Sul province, Narciso Benedito, stated on Thursday that investment in young people is a decisive factor in securing the country’s future, with a focus on education, training, entrepreneurship and social inclusion.

Speaking at the opening of the JMPLA’s multidisciplinary camp, the party official encouraged young people to take an active role in national development, as well as in civic and political life.

Narciso Benedito reaffirmed the party’s commitment to sustainable development and the well-being of the population, noting that improving the living conditions of Angolan families depends on access to education, healthcare, housing, employment and dignity, as well as on actively listening to communities.

The politician highlighted the political significance of the moment, given the preparations for the party’s 9th Ordinary Congress, under the slogan “MPLA – 70 years, commitment to the people, confidence in the future”.

The event, which runs until Sunday in the town of Quipela, in the municipality of Gângula, brings together 770 JMPLA activists from the province’s 24 municipalities.

During the meeting, participants will discuss topics related to active citizenship, youth leadership, political participation, the responsible use of social media and mental health, as well as visiting academic and research institutions in the province.
